Szpakowska et al. also analyzed conolidone and its action around the ACKR3 receptor, which helps to elucidate its Earlier unknown system of action in the two acute and chronic pain Manage (fifty eight). It had been found that receptor levels of ACKR3 had been as substantial or simply larger as All those from the endogenous opiate procedure and had been correlated to equivalent regions of the CNS. This receptor was also not modulated by basic opiate agonists, which include morphine, fentanyl, buprenorphine, or antagonists like naloxone. In a rat product, it absolutely was found that a competitor molecule binding to ACKR3 resulted in inhibition of ACKR3’s inhibitory action, resulting in an Over-all increase in opiate receptor exercise.

We shown that, in distinction to classical opioid receptors, ACKR3 won't bring about classical G protein signaling and isn't modulated through the classical prescription or analgesic opioids, for instance morphine, fentanyl, or buprenorphine, or by nonselective opioid antagonists for example naloxone. As an alternative, we recognized that LIH383, an ACKR3-selective subnanomolar competitor peptide, stops ACKR3’s unfavorable regulatory function on opioid peptides in an ex vivo rat brain product and potentiates their exercise in the direction of classical opioid receptors.

Vegetation happen to be Traditionally a source of analgesic alkaloids, While their pharmacological characterization is usually confined. Amid this kind of purely natural analgesic molecules, conolidine, located in the bark in the tropical flowering shrub Tabernaemontana divaricata, also known as pinwheel flower or crepe jasmine, has extended been Utilized in traditional Chinese, Ayurvedic and Thai medicines to deal with fever and pain4 (Fig. 1a). Pharmacologists have only recently been capable to verify its medicinal and pharmacological Qualities because of its initially asymmetric overall synthesis.five Conolidine is usually a rare C5-nor stemmadenine (Fig. 1b), which shows strong analgesia in in vivo models of tonic and persistent pain and minimizes inflammatory pain relief. It was also recommended that conolidine-induced analgesia may well deficiency troubles ordinarily associated with classical opioid medicines.
